Additional Information
Plans deposited: 2 sheets
- site plan , Elevation + section.
Also included letter dated (2 April 1892) 2 years after initial application requesting permission to re-build the wall in accordance with original plans submitted, (this was approved and signed by Harvey Sutcliffe). The letter was signed by both Thomas Wetherby & R.S. Dugdale Esq. (Architect)
